This photograph was taken as part of a
"Moods and Emotions" series that I photographed for someone.. The black and white tone in combination with the person staring out of the window into nothing is meant to represent the emptiness that the person is feeling inside. The off angle of the window represents how we sometimes feel "off" and are unable to correct our depressed or anxious moods.
